Method B
1. Start with Paranoid Android, OMNI or any other AOSP-based ROM.
2. Back up all data with Titanium backup and copy everything you need from your internal storage. ATTENTION: The internal storage will be wiped while flashing, so the backup MUST be on your SD-Card.
3. Copy dload folder to SD-Card or internal storage. (there should be no difference)
4. Boot to TWRP and make a backup in-case something goes wrong.
5. In TWRP wipe everything except internal and external storage.
6. In TWRP choose reboot to bootloader. Confirm that no OS is installed and don't install SuperSU.
7. Plug your phone in your PC and open a CMD.
8. Download B510 recovery.img and boot.img from this thread http://forum.xda-developers.com/show...php?p=51718316.
9. Follow the instructions by @surdu_petru(method1)
(or use this(method 2)choose install recovery image first, then the boot image
or use Method 3>
copy both the recovery and boot img files to your adb folder then>
run these commands:
adb reboot bootloader
fastboot flash recovery recovery.img
fastboot flash boot boot.img
fastboot reboot recovery
. IMPORTANT: When the flashing is finished and the phone reboots unplug the USB cable then wait for recovery to open and let it install.
10. You are finished!! The first boot takes some time no need to panic.
Additional:
Reinstall TWRP and flash SuperSU for Root. Than you can restore your backup you made in the second step.

Easiest Way to Install MiUI 11 (Clean) on Redmi Note 5 India/ Redmi 5 Plus (Vince).

I installed a Pixel Experience (Android 10) on my unlocked Redmi Note 5 India / Redmi 5 Plus (Vince) (Here on I'll refer to the device on Vince). Volte and data didn't work, and the call quality was pretty bad, so I decided to go back to the official MIUI and the Mi recovery.
This guide basically explains the easiest way to go back MIUI. Assuming your phone is unlocked. I'm adding direct download links to MIUI and other Mi tools because they are blocked in India.
Download Links:
Link 1: Normal Update ROM (Zip File)[bigota<dot>d<dot>miui<dot>com/V11.0.2.0.OEGMIXM/miui_HM5PlusGlobal_V11.0.2.0.OEGMIXM_f74369de0c_8.1.zip]
Link 2: Fastboot ROM (tgz File)[bigota<dot>d<dot>miui<dot>com/V11.0.2.0.OEGMIXM/vince_global_images_V11.0.2.0.OEGMIXM_20191108.0000.00_8.1_global_90dd70aa99.tgz]
Link 3: Last Updated Stable ROM(zip file)[update<dot>miui<dot>com/updates/v1/fullromdownload.php?d=vince_global&b=F&r=global&n=]
Link 4: Last Updated Beta ROM(zip file)[update<dot>miui<dot>com/updates/v1/fullromdownload.php?d=vince_global&b=X&r=global&n=]
Link 5: MiFlash(rar file)[cdn<dot>alsgp0<dot>fds<dot>api<dot>mi-img<dot>com/micomm/MiFlash2020-3-14-0.rar]
Link 6: Mi PC Suite(exe file)[bigota<dot>d<dot>miui<dot>com/MiFlash/MiSetup2.2.0.7032_2717.exe]
Link 7: This is not a direct link download twrp from one of the servers a direct link TWRP for Vince(img file) [twrp<dot>me/xiaomi/xiaomiredmi5plus<dot>html]
Link 8: This is not a direct link download Unlock tool from the page MIUI Unlock Tool(zip file) [en<dot>miui<dot>com/unlock/download_en<dot>html]
Link 9: This is not a direct link download Orangefox recovery tool from the page Orangefox Recovery(zip file)[orangefox<dot>download/en/device/vince]
Steps:
1. Download MIUI Unlock tool(Link 8) and extract it. Open cmd prompt inside the folder.
2. Switch your phone to fastboot mode (power + volume down). Connect it to your PC.
3. The device should show up when you enter "fastboot devices" in cmd.
4. Download TWRP (Link 7). extract it, rename it to "twrp.img" copy the image and copy it to the MIUI unlock tool. Now run "fastboot boot twrp.img". This should automatically take you to TWRP.
5. Now wipe everything. If you are not able to mount "data". Go to "Wipe", "Advanced", "Repair" then change the format of the data to exFat, then to FAT then to Ext4. This should mount data.
6. You should see your phone on your PC, if not mount USB in TWRP. Download orangefox recovery from Link 9. Copy it and flash it from twrp. Your phone will restart. Go to recovery mode and you should see orangefox.
7. Download fastboot ROM from Link 2. Unzip it copy "persist.img" from the folder to your phone, flash it using orangefox.
8. Download MiFlash tool from Link 5. Extract it and run it. Select the folder where you extracted fastboot ROM. MAKE SURE THAT THE PATH DOESN'T HAVE ANY SPACES OR FLASHING WILL FAIL. Now hit refresh on flash tool. It will show your device, at the bottom there is a selection where you can select the script to be executed. I generally select flash_all.bat, you can select flash_all_lock.bat for a locked OS.
It might show you "error:Not catch checkpoint (\$fastboot -s .*lock),flash is not done", but your phone will boot properly, it will show a success message only if you choose lock option bat. But this error shouldn't affect the installation.
9. Restart your phone, everything should work properly.

How To Guide [ALIOTH/ALIOTHIN] HOW TO FLASH A ROM IN TWRP WITHOUT ERROR

Hello everyone, today i will show you how to flash any rom via TWRP with alioth / aliothin
1- Download this version of TWRP (vasi version): https://drive.google.com/uc?id=1oY5WxfXYPRLumCcaPPFGuq9OhtB3CM_X&export=download
2- Install SDK: https://developer.android.com/studio/releases/platform-tools
3- Install MiFlash (only for drivers): https://xiaomiflashtool.com/download/xiaomi-flash-tool-20210226
3- Download the rom you want to install.
4- Extract Mi Flash tool and launching the executable, it will offer to install the drivers click on install then wait for a pop'up in chinese and close the software
5- Extract SDK then put the twrp in the folder (platform-tools-windows)
6- Launch cmd from the folder
7- Write "fastboot boot twrp-aliothin.img" in the cmd
8- Your phone is on the twrp, drag and drop your rom into the internal storage of your smartphone
9- go to install then select your rom
10- Swipe to install (check that inject twrp is checked)
11- reboot in the recovery in the reboot section
12- Click on wipe then format data, write yes then restart in the system
ENJOY!
